The pixie frog is not the kind of frog you'd find hopping harmlessly around your garden pond. Also called the African giant bullfrog, this enormous amphibian is known scientifically as Pyxicephalus adspersus .
It's one of the largest frogs in the world and plays an important ecological role in sub-Saharan Africa by helping control populations of insects and other small animals.
Pixie frogs spend much of their life buried beneath the soil, enclosed in a hardened cocoon formed from shed skin to retain moisture. This adaptation allows them to survive extreme droughts until the rains and high humidity levels of the rainy season return.
